Output 24b1599d6c40d7bcfb7353883f3f912aed99e803b5eb63a0d1df3ddf18e58c21:10

value
7923717
script pubkey
OP_0 OP_PUSHBYTES_20 b8a32cc0b581237d0cb0fcbf84641690138cfc0f
address
ltc1qhz3jes94sy3h6r9sljlcgeqkjqfcelq06vp7uh
transaction
24b1599d6c40d7bcfb7353883f3f912aed99e803b5eb63a0d1df3ddf18e58c21
spent
true